Introduction to Crested Gecko Genetics
Crested Geckos, scientifically often called Correlophus ciliatus, have attained enormous popularity amid reptile fans due to their vivid colors, exceptional morphs, and relatively effortless treatment needs. Having said that, powering their amazing look lies a fancy Website of genetics that dictates their different features and traits. Comprehension Crested Gecko Genetics is crucial for breeders and hobbyists alike, as it may noticeably influence breeding results and the overall overall health of the geckos.

Knowing Polygenic Attributes in Crested Geckos
A lot of the morphological features noticed in Crested Geckos are polygenic, meaning They're controlled by a number of genes. By way of example, the variation in coloration shades, including the well-known ‘Flame’ or ‘Dalmatian’ morphs, occurs in the interplay of various genes influencing pigmentation and sample progress. This polygenic nature adds a layer of complexity to breeding, as predicting the phenotype from the offspring needs comprehension how these genes interact.

An summary of Preferred Morphs
Some of the most popular morphs incorporate:

Lilly White: Recognized for its placing white coloration and iridescence, the Lilly White morph is often a remarkably sought-just after trait among the breeders.
Dalmatian: This morph encompasses a foundation coloration that can range from yellow to orange, adorned with random dark spots, resembling a Dalmatian dog.
Flame: A vivid morph characterized by a bright base color with darker hues and a flame-like pattern, making it visually striking.
Brindle: Brindle geckos display a mix of color strips or styles that resemble the brindle coat sample located in some Doggy breeds.

Issues in Breeding Crested Geckos
Breeding Crested Geckos isn’t devoid of difficulties. Genetic range is important to maintaining nutritious populations, and extreme focus on aesthetics may result in inbreeding. In addition, breeder inexperience may lead to problems that impact the wellbeing and viability in the offspring. Seasoned breeders often advocate sustaining a various breeding stock and frequently educating oneself about genetic ideas that affect Crested Gecko characteristics.
